Ethereum's Positioning and Significance

In 2015, Vitalik Buterin and co-founders launched Ethereum (ETH), aiming to address the limitations of existing blockchain platforms by introducing programmable smart contracts.

As the first major smart contract platform, Ethereum plays a crucial role in DeFi, NFTs, and decentralized applications (dApps).

As of 2025, Ethereum has become the second-larg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, boasting over 413 million unique addresses and a thriving developer ecosystem. This article will delve into its technical architecture, market performance, and future potential.

Origins and Development History

Birth Background

Ethereum was created by Vitalik Buterin and co-founders in 2015, with the goal of expanding blockchain technology beyond simple value transfer to support complex, programmable applications.

It emerged during the early blockchain boom, aiming to provide a platform for decentralized applications and smart contracts, opening up new possibilities for developers and users across various industries.

Important Milestones

  • 2015: Mainnet launch, introducing smart contract functionality to blockchain technology.
  • 2022: The Merge upgrade transitioned Ethereum from Proof-of-Work to Proof-of-Stake, significantly reducing energy consumption.
  • 2023: Shanghai upgrade enabled staking withdrawals, enhancing liquidity for ETH stakers.
  • 2025: Ecosystem explosion, with thousands of dApps and DeFi protocols built on Ethereum.

With support from the Ethereum Foundation and a global community of developers, Ethereum continues to optimize its technology, security, and real-world applications.

How Does Ethereum Work?

No Central Control

Ethereum operates on a decentralized network of computers (nodes) worldwide, free from control by banks or governments. These nodes collaborate to validate transactions, ensuring system transparency and attack resistance, granting users greater autonomy and enhancing network resilience.

Blockchain Core

Ethereum's blockchain is a public, immutable digital ledger recording every transaction. Transactions are grouped into blocks, linked through cryptographic hashes to form a secure chain. Anyone can view the records, establishing trust without intermediaries. Layer 2 solutions and upcoming sharding technology further enhance performance.

Ensuring Fairness

Ethereum uses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us to validate transactions and prevent fraudulent activities like double-spending. Validators stake ETH to maintain network security and receive ETH rewards. This innovative approach is significantly more energy-efficient than the previous Proof-of-Work system.

Secure Transactions

Ethereum uses public-private key cryptography to protect transactions:

  • Private keys (like secret passwords) are used to sign transactions
  • Public keys (like account numbers) are used to verify ownership

This mechanism ensures fund security while transactions remain pseudonymous. Additional features like smart contract audits and formal verification enhance security for decentralized applications built on Ethereum.

Ethereum Ecosystem Applications and Partnerships

Core Use Cases

Ethereum's ecosystem supports various applications:

  • DeFi: Uniswap, providing decentralized exchange services.
  • NFTs: OpenSea, driving digital collectibles and art marketplaces.
  • GameFi: Axie Infinity, promoting blockchain-based gaming.

Strategic Collaborations

Ethereum has established partnerships with Microsoft, ConsenSys, and Enterprise Ethereum Alliance, enhancing its technological capabilities and market influence. These partnerships provide a solid foundation for Ethereum's ecosystem expansion.

Controversies and Challenges

Ethereum faces the following challenges:

  • Technical Issues: Scalability bottlenecks and high gas fees
  • Regulatory Risks: Potential SEC scrutiny on ETH's security status
  • Competitive Pressure: Rise of alternative Layer 1 blockchains

These issues have sparked discussions within the community and market, driving Ethereum's continuous innovation.

FAQ

What is ETH used for?

ETH is used to pay for transactions, execute smart contracts, and secure the Ethereum network. It's also a digital asset for investment and decentralized finance applications.

Why is ETH worth money?

ETH has value due to its utility in the Ethereum network, serving as fuel for transactions and smart contracts. Its scarcity and growing demand also contribute to its worth.
